打印
[开发工具]

官方DEMO程序DEBUG出现错误提示【已解决】

[复制链接]
1753|19
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
ThinkIC|  楼主 | 2019-7-31 22:42 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
BUG, demo, se, TI, ce
本帖最后由 麦小播 于 2019-8-9 17:14 编辑

The target device is not ready for debugging. Please check your configuration bit settings and program the device before proceeding. The most common causes for this failure are oscillator and/or PGC/PGD settings.

请教各位高手:
请问以上错误提示大概会是什么问题?

使用特权

评论回复
沙发
ThinkIC|  楼主 | 2019-7-31 22:49 | 只看该作者
对了,编程设备是PICkit3!我初学,请指教!

使用特权

评论回复
评论
lihui567 2019-8-3 08:49 回复TA
官方的demo程序? 
板凳
天灵灵地灵灵| | 2019-7-31 23:26 | 只看该作者
说配置位没有弄对。

使用特权

评论回复
地板
ThinkIC|  楼主 | 2019-7-31 23:31 | 只看该作者

哦,谢谢。配置位的问题要看具体芯片的DATASHEET吗?

使用特权

评论回复
5
ThinkIC|  楼主 | 2019-7-31 23:35 | 只看该作者

官网demo程序,可以编译通过,但是运行不正常,准备debug解决问题,结果debug模式都进不去!

使用特权

评论回复
6
天灵灵地灵灵| | 2019-7-31 23:35 | 只看该作者
ThinkIC 发表于 2019-7-31 23:31
哦,谢谢。配置位的问题要看具体芯片的DATASHEET吗?

对啊,不是所有芯片的配置位都一样的,你肯定要下载你用的芯片手册看看配置位怎么设置的。

使用特权

评论回复
7
天灵灵地灵灵| | 2019-7-31 23:36 | 只看该作者
ThinkIC 发表于 2019-7-31 23:35
官网demo程序,可以编译通过,但是运行不正常,准备debug解决问题,结果debug模式都进不去! ...

DEMO里面有配置位?这个是你用的哪个型号的DEMO吗

使用特权

评论回复
8
ThinkIC|  楼主 | 2019-7-31 23:42 | 只看该作者
官网买的dsPIC33FJ128GP804 pim用的explorer 16/32开发板(240001)运行的demo是PIM同名例程

使用特权

评论回复
9
ThinkIC|  楼主 | 2019-7-31 23:43 | 只看该作者
还买了其它芯片PIM,跑同名DEMO都没有问题,debug也能进去

使用特权

评论回复
10
ThinkIC|  楼主 | 2019-8-1 12:41 | 只看该作者
天灵灵地灵灵 发表于 2019-7-31 23:36
DEMO里面有配置位?这个是你用的哪个型号的DEMO吗

官网买的dsPIC33FJ128GP804 pim用的explorer 16/32开发板(240001)运行的demo是PIM同名例程;
还买了其它型号的pim,相应DEMO都顺利执行。
只有GP804,主程序都一样,但是就是开发板自带LCD不显示!

使用特权

评论回复
11
小卡| | 2019-8-2 16:05 | 只看该作者
加分类~ 楼主加油~

使用特权

评论回复
12
programmable| | 2019-8-6 13:37 | 只看该作者
没有配置好的问题吧

使用特权

评论回复
13
ThinkIC|  楼主 | 2019-8-6 21:35 | 只看该作者
programmable 发表于 2019-8-6 13:37
没有配置好的问题吧

大神,有兴趣的话帮忙看看。
我刚刚入门,很多东西都不知道。
开发板是官网Explorer 16/32,编译器是XC16免费版。

dspic33fj128gp804_pim.x.zip

30.9 KB

使用特权

评论回复
14
ThinkIC|  楼主 | 2019-8-6 21:41 | 只看该作者
感谢各位大神,DEBUG模式能进去了,是我太毛糙没有看官方demo的配置文件的英文说明!

使用特权

评论回复
15
ThinkIC|  楼主 | 2019-8-7 22:42 | 只看该作者
Microchip的客服终于回应了,问题解决了,结帖!谢谢大家!

使用特权

评论回复
16
21mengnan| | 2019-8-7 23:33 | 只看该作者
哈哈,什么说明,之前是为何啊,不是应该直接就行的吗

使用特权

评论回复
17
ThinkIC|  楼主 | 2019-8-8 22:03 | 只看该作者
21mengnan 发表于 2019-8-7 23:33
哈哈,什么说明,之前是为何啊,不是应该直接就行的吗

位设置部分也就是system.c文件部分位设置部分后面的注释。
官网demo可以编译通过,可以运行,但是DEBUG模式进不去!必须根据注释把PGD1改成PGD3才行!

使用特权

评论回复
18
麦小播| | 2019-8-9 17:14 | 只看该作者
加个已解决,供同样有debug问题的人参考

使用特权

评论回复
19
CoolSilicon| | 2019-8-13 13:55 | 只看该作者
ThinkIC 发表于 2019-8-8 22:03
位设置部分也就是system.c文件部分位设置部分后面的注释。
官网demo可以编译通过,可以运行,但是DEBUG模 ...

对于有多组PGD/PGC的芯片, 只是烧录话的, 随便你接哪一组都是可行的..
但是,如果要debug的话, 需要根据你硬件的连接,在配置字中设置相应的那一组才行..

这个在datasheet中是有说明的...

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

4

主题

28

帖子

0

粉丝